Being a teenager.

When people reach the age of 18 they become adults in the eyes of law.
They can vote, obtain passports by themselves, get a driving-licence, join the army, get married, sign contracts, buy land and buildings. They do not need their parents’ permission if they want to have a full-time job and earn a living. When you are 18 you take on more duties and responsibilities and if you happen to break the law you are punished. Teenagers feel they have a right to be independent. Sixteen and seventeen-year-olds are allowed to enjoy more and more freedom. They can have a part-time job, but they mustn’t work in school hours, so 13-year-olds can deliver newspapers to people’s homes and teenage girls can babysit. In general 16 or 17-year-olds get a driving-licence and can drive or ride a motorbike. Teenagers want to be more and more independent. They desire to spend time with the company they like, come back home later and later, wear clothes they like, listen to crazy music, choose their own way. Some teenagers seem to be under the strong influence of their peers. In some cases poor relationships with their parents cause more troubles and disagreements. We call such poor relationships ,,a generation gap”. Not all adults know what growing up really means.
